diff --git a/arch/arm64/include/asm/kvm_hypevents.h b/arch/arm64/include/asm/kvm_hypevents.h index cb93232138b9..664d61c70ccc 100644 --- a/arch/arm64/include/asm/kvm_hypevents.h +++ b/arch/arm64/include/asm/kvm_hypevents.h @@ -142,7 +142,7 @@ HYP_EVENT(vcpu_illegal_trap, HE_PRINTK("esr_el2=%llx", __entry->esr) ); -#ifdef CONFIG_PROTECTED_NVHE_TESTING +#ifdef CONFIG_PKVM_SELFTESTS HYP_EVENT(selftest, HE_PROTO(void), HE_STRUCT(), diff --git a/arch/arm64/kvm/Kconfig b/arch/arm64/kvm/Kconfig index 5399c8ca7267..1e9c6f23612d 100644 --- a/arch/arm64/kvm/Kconfig +++ b/arch/arm64/kvm/Kconfig @@ -122,15 +122,6 @@ config PTDUMP_STAGE2_DEBUGFS If in doubt, say N. -config PROTECTED_NVHE_TESTING - bool "Protected KVM hypervisor testing infrastructure" - depends on KVM - default n - help - Say Y here to enable pKVM hypervisor testing infrastructure. - - If unsure, say N. - config PROTECTED_NVHE_FTRACE bool "Protected KVM hypervisor function tracing" depends on KVM diff --git a/arch/arm64/kvm/hyp/nvhe/hyp-main.c b/arch/arm64/kvm/hyp/nvhe/hyp-main.c index df0035c048a6..24151339cf5a 100644 --- a/arch/arm64/kvm/hyp/nvhe/hyp-main.c +++ b/arch/arm64/kvm/hyp/nvhe/hyp-main.c @@ -1594,7 +1594,7 @@ static void handle___pkvm_selftest_event(struct kvm_cpu_context *host_ctxt) { int smc_ret = SMCCC_RET_NOT_SUPPORTED, ret = -EOPNOTSUPP; -#ifdef CONFIG_PROTECTED_NVHE_TESTING +#ifdef CONFIG_PKVM_SELFTESTS trace_selftest(); smc_ret = SMCCC_RET_SUCCESS; ret = 0; diff --git a/arch/arm64/kvm/hyp_trace.c b/arch/arm64/kvm/hyp_trace.c index 06ebdf11a930..5ae756241dc7 100644 --- a/arch/arm64/kvm/hyp_trace.c +++ b/arch/arm64/kvm/hyp_trace.c @@ -884,7 +884,7 @@ static int hyp_trace_clock_show(struct seq_file *m, void *v) } DEFINE_SHOW_ATTRIBUTE(hyp_trace_clock); -#ifdef CONFIG_PROTECTED_NVHE_TESTING +#ifdef CONFIG_PKVM_SELFTESTS static int selftest_event_open(struct inode *inode, struct file *file) { if (file->f_mode & FMODE_WRITE)